Elon Musk teases playful name for SpaceX’s first Moonbase
Elon Musk suggests 'Auda City', a potential name for company’s future project
Elon Musk is once again making headlines for his sense of humour. The tech billionaire recently suggested a potential name for the company’s future project.
Taking to X (formerly Twitter), the SpaceX CEO posted, “Moonbase name: Auda City, or is it too luney?”
Though Musk didn’t confirm whether this will be the official name, the suggestion instantly sparked excitement among his millions of followers.
Just days earlier, he also teased that SpaceX’s Starship will be used to “build Moonbase Alpha,” a reference to NASA’s 2010 simulation game “Moonbase Alpha.”
Set in 2032, the game allowed players to act as astronauts repairing a lunar base, an uncanny coincidence with Musk’s real-life ambitions to establish a functioning habitat on the Moon within the next decade.
Notably,the idea of Moonbase Alpha has been a long-standing part of Musk’s vision for human space exploration.
According to SpaceX’s earlier plans, the lunar base would serve as a testing ground for technologies needed to support life on Mars.
While the name might sound like another one of Musk’s playful jabs, it also reflects his bold vision i.e., to make life multiplanetary.
